Devin's DVD case has 3 rows of slots, but 5 slots are broken.If x equals the number of slots in a row explain how the expression

3x — 5 relates to Devin's DVD case

Answer:

The total number of unbroken / working slots

Step-by-step explanation:

Given that Devin's DVD case has 3 rows of slots, but 5 slots are broken

Also given that the number of slots in a row is x

1 row has x slots

3 rows has y slots

on cross multiplication we get y = 3x

ie there are a total of 3x slots in the 3 rows

Given that out of these 3x slots 5 . of the slots are broken

Therefore the total number of working slots = total number of slots - number of slots which are broken

total number of working slots are = 3x - 5

Therefore the given expression is the number of working / good slots

The ingredients given are for 4 dozen cookies; however, Christian only want to make one dozen, meaning he requires only 1/4 the ingredients.

1/4 of 2 1/4 cups of while sugar is found the following way.

First, we write 2 1/4 as an improper fraction

2\frac{1}{4}=2+\frac{1}{4}=\frac{9}{4}

1/4 of this is

\frac{9}{4}\times\frac{1}{4}=\frac{9}{16}

Hence, Christian requires 9/16 cups of white sugar.

Similarly, the 1/4 of 3/4 cups of brown sugar is

\frac{1}{4}\times\frac{3}{4}=\frac{3}{16}

Hence, Chrisitan requires 3/16 cups of brown sugar.

Therefore, the total cups of sugar required is the sum of

\frac{3}{16}+\frac{9}{16}=\frac{12}{16}=\frac{3}{4}

3/4 cups of sugar.
